What is the Tasmanian Freight Equalisation Scheme Claimant Information Form?

The Tasmanian Freight Equalisation Scheme Claimant Information Form is vital for individuals applying for the Tasmanian Freight Equalisation Scheme. This form is necessary for both new claimants and those needing to update their existing information. It requires essential details such as the Australian Business Number (ABN), postal address, and physical address of the claimant.
This form serves a crucial role in facilitating the claims process and ensuring accurate information is submitted to the relevant authorities.

Purpose and Benefits of the Tasmanian Freight Equalisation Scheme

The Tasmanian Freight Equalisation Scheme aims to reduce the freight costs for individuals and businesses operating in Tasmania, thus promoting economic growth and fairness. By compensating claimants for the transport costs of goods to and from Tasmania, the scheme provides both financial and logistical support.
Claimants benefit from reduced transport expenses, enabling them to remain competitive in a challenging market. Additionally, the scheme supports broader economic activities in Tasmania, fostering business sustainability.
